Henry IV, also known as Henry Bolingbroke, was King of England from 1399 to 1413. Henry's grandfather Edward III had begun the Hundred Years War by claiming the French throne in opposition to the House of Valois, a claim that Henry would continue... Wikipedia
Born: April 1367, Bolingbroke Castle, Old Bolingbroke, United Kingdom
Died: March 20, 1413 (age 45 years), Jerusalem Chamber
Children: Henry V, Philippa of England, John of Lancaster, Duke of Bedford, and more
Parents: John of Gaunt and Blanche of Lancaster
Grandchildren: Henry VI, Antigone of Gloucester, Countess of Tankerville, John de Clarence, and more
Spouse: Joan of Navarre, Queen of England (m. 1403–1413) and Mary de Bohun (m. 1380–1394)
